In a revelation that has left many stunned, Bollywood actress Kangana Ranaut recently disclosed that she had been advocating for the renaming of ‘India’ to ‘Bharat’ for the past two years. The actress made this surprising claim in a recent interview, sparking a fresh wave of debates and discussions across social media platforms.Kangana Ranaut, known for her outspoken nature and strong opinions, stated that she had approached government officials with the proposal to rename the country. According to her, the name ‘India’ does not capture the essence and rich history of the nation, and ‘Bharat’ would be a more fitting title.
The revelation has led to a mixed bag of reactions from the public. While some applaud her for taking a stand on an issue that resonates with national identity, others criticize her for stirring the pot and creating unnecessary controversy.Kangana’s statement comes at a time when the country is already embroiled in various debates concerning its identity and history. Her comments have added fuel to the fire, prompting politicians to weigh in on the matter. So far, no official statements have been made by the government regarding any plans to rename the country.It remains to be seen whether Kangana’s revelation will lead to any concrete action or if it will remain a topic of heated debate. What is certain is that the actress has once again succeeded in capturing the nation’s attention, for better or for worse.
